How long can you marinate chicken wings?
The marinade time for chicken wings can suit your schedule. It is great to marinade the wings for at least 30 mins.
Overnight is perfect if you have the time.
The goal of the marinade is to pack maximum flavour into the wings. Don't worry if you want to eat straight away and don't have the time to wait for the marinade to sit for hours. Your wings will still taste amazing. Just know, that the option is there if you want to marinade for longer.

How to cook chicken wings in the oven
The 2 photos below are to show you the marinated wings before and after cooking. As you can see they are still quite pale even though they are cooked, so we then pop them under the broiler to crisp up the skin.
If you remember, we also did that for our Slow Cooker Lemon Garlic Chicken. It is a great fast way of cooking chicken skin.
The step to crisp up the skin of your wings is the thing that takes them from 'pretty good' to bomb diggity chicken wings.
It only takes about 10-15 mins under the broiler for the chicken skin to get crispy. Keep an eye on them during this process as it happens faster than you think!

Can I freeze chicken wings
Yes!! You can freeze chicken wings.
If you want to freeze this recipe, I would do that once the marinade is coating the wings and before they are cooked. This is a good meal prep option too for busy weeks.
Throw the whole bag into the freezer and when you are ready to cook the wings, simply let them defrost in the fridge for a few hours.

Honey Garlic Chicken Wings
Equipment
- Baking dish
- Oven rack
- Baking tray
Ingredients
Honey Garlic Chicken Wings
- 700 grams chicken wings Note 3
- ½ cup honey
- 2 tablespoon garlic granules Note 2
- ¾ cup ginger beer Note 4
- 1 tablespoon dried onion
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on pepper
Instructions
Honey Garlic Chicken Wings
- Preheat oven to 200°c/400°F, gas 6
- Combine marinade ingredients in a large jar, seal and shake to mix together Note 1
- Add chicken wings to zip lock bag and then pour marinade in to cover. Seal and massage with hands to spread around.
- Place marinade in the fridge for at least 30 mins, up to overnight
- Line a baking tray with greaseproof paper
- Pour chicken wing marinade mix into baking tray and use tongs to arrange so all are flat
- Bake for 30 - 40 mins, rotating ½ way through. Use a skewer after 30 mins to pierce near the bone of the largest piece and see the colour of the juices. If they are clear, remove from the oven, if they are stil slightly pink, continue to cook for the further 10 mins
- Line a baking tray with greaseproof paper and place a cooking wrack on top. Place wings onto rack. Keep leftover marinade juice for drizzle
- Change oven to grill setting (same temperature) and grill for 10 mins to crisp up the skin
- Top with thinly sliced radishes, shallots and sesame seeds. Use remaining marinade for drizzle.
Notes
- Note 1 if you don't have a large jar to make your marinade in, a medium bowl will be fine to use.
- Note 2 these are dried granules in the spice aisle. They are perfect for this recipe and full of flavour!
- Note 3 the recipe will stretch to 1kg of chicken wings, don't worry about making extra marinade. If you are cooking 1.2 kg or more wings then I would double the marinade batch.
- Note 4 the ginger beer I use if the regular one in the soft drink aisle at the shops. I have tried a nice alcoholic one that you get from the bottle shop and by all means, go ahead if you want to try the R rated version of ginger beer with your wings.
